WASHINGTON, D.C. - The U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ission, in cooperation with the firm named below, today announced a voluntary recall of the following consumer product. Consumers should stop using recalled products immediately unless otherwise instructed. It is illegal to resell or attempt to resell a recalled consumer product.
Name of Product: SLA90 Youth All-Terrain Vehicles (ATVs)
Units: About 144
Distributor: SunL Group Inc., of Irving, Texas
Hazard: The youth ATV lacks front brakes, a manual fuel shut-off, and padding to cover the sharp edges on the handlebar assembly. Additionally, the vehicle is sold without a tire pressure gauge or adequate flag pole bracket. The defects could lead to young drivers losing control of the ATVs, which poses the risk of serious injuries or death.
Incidents/Injuries: None.
Description: The recalled SLA90 ATVs are intended for children between the ages of 12 and 15 years old. The recalled SLA90 ATVs were available in the following solid colors: red, blue, yellow, green. The ATVs were available in the following camo colors: pink, brown, green, and blue. The word "Sunl" is on the front side of the ATV. Sold through: SunL Group dealers nationwide and Web retailers from May 2005 through March 2007 for between $400 and $500.
Manufactured in: China
Remedy: Consumers should immediately stop using these ATVs. The firm is no longer in business and a remedy is no longer available.
